Module: Castronaut

Defined in:
lib/castronaut.rb,
lib/castronaut/configuration.rb,
lib/castronaut/ticket_result.rb,
lib/castronaut/support/sample.rb,
lib/castronaut/models/dispenser.rb,
lib/castronaut/presenters/login.rb,
lib/castronaut/presenters/logout.rb,
lib/castronaut/adapters/ldap/user.rb,
lib/castronaut/models/consumeable.rb,
lib/castronaut/models/login_ticket.rb,
lib/castronaut/models/proxy_ticket.rb,
lib/castronaut/adapters/ldap/adapter.rb,
lib/castronaut/authentication_result.rb,
lib/castronaut/models/service_ticket.rb,
lib/castronaut/utilities/random_string.rb,
lib/castronaut/presenters/process_login.rb,
lib/castronaut/adapters/development/user.rb,
lib/castronaut/presenters/proxy_validate.rb,
lib/castronaut/presenters/service_validate.rb,
lib/castronaut/adapters/development/adapter.rb,
lib/castronaut/models/proxy_granting_ticket.rb,
lib/castronaut/models/ticket_granting_ticket.rb,
lib/castronaut/adapters/restful_authentication/user.rb,
lib/castronaut/adapters/restful_authentication/adapter.rb

Defined Under Namespace

Modules: Adapters, Models, Presenters, Support, Utilities Classes: AuthenticationResult, Configuration, TicketResult

Class Method Summary collapse

Class Method Details

.configObject



28
29
30
# File 'lib/castronaut.rb', line 28

def self.config
  @cas_config
end

.config=(config) ⇒ Object



32
33
34
# File 'lib/castronaut.rb', line 32

def self.config=(config)
  @cas_config = config
end

.loggerObject



36
37
38
# File 'lib/castronaut.rb', line 36

def self.logger
  @cas_config.logger
end